Sandra Ann Pence

Sandra Ann Pence, 77, of Terre Haute, passed away on Saturday, February 8, 2025, at her home, surrounded by her family. She was born on July 31, 1947, in Louisville, Kentucky to Dwight Edmondson Harreld and Norma Louise Kilkelly. 

Sandy is survived by her husband, Ralph Pence; her children, Julie Daugherty (Terry) and Daniel Leasor (Jamie); stepchildren, Christy Ellis (Kaleel) and Benjamin Pence; grandchildren, Michelle Daugherty, Ryan Daugherty (Delaney), Kelly Daugherty, Taylor Hughes (Jordan), Hannah Opthof (Derek), Christopher Leasor, Kalea Ellis, Karah Ellis (Joshua), Jackson Pence, Christopher Ellis, Lilly Pence and Khloe Ellis; siblings, Susan Egan (Michael), Dani Reynolds, and Michael Harreld (Suzy), sisters-in-law, Patty Bumphus and Paulette Ahmadi (Cash); and a brother-in-law, Fred Pence (Diana). She was also looking forward to the arrival of her great-grandson, Beau. She also leaves behind many nieces and nephews, all of whom cherished her and held her in high regard. 

She was preceded in death by her parents and a brother-in-law, Roger Reynolds.

Sandy worked for many years as a banquet server at The Galt House hotel in Louisville. She and Ralph were active in leading and participating in a military family support group during her son’s deployments in Iraq. She was also an integral leader in a cancer support group at the Hux Cancer Center. She loved to go on her walks, generally trekking an average of 3 miles, no matter how tired she was. Most of all, she loved to spend time with her grandchildren. Sandy could always be found at their sporting events, cheering them on from the sidelines. Sandy was kind, warm, loving, and a fighter to the end. Her memory will be treasured.
